Khartoum, March 8, 2026 (SUNA) – Minister of Human Resources and Social Welfare Mutasim Ahmed Saleh announced an agreement with Darfur Region Governor Minni Arko Minnawi to coordinate the provision of relief for displaced persons (IDPs) in the region and create livelihood opportunities for them.Speaking to reporters following a meeting with the Darfur Region Governor at the ministry’s headquarters in Khartoum on Sunday, the minister said the discussions also addressed training opportunities for Sudanese university students in Darfur as well as displaced students.Minister Saleh described the provision of employment opportunities for displaced persons and citizens as an important priority.BH/BH
